^ you are most likely going to have several bent valves. Midwest is the best place to take stuff, but if you look on NASIOC and around other subie sites, you might be able to find a set of good ones. These DOHCs are not cheap to rebuild, mine had 2 bent valves, and but the time I had everything fixed/milled I have about $600 into mine.
